#dd8d8d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d8d8d is composed of 86.7% red, 55.3%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.2% magenta, 36.2%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 54.1% and a lightness of 71%. #dd8d8d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bb1b1b.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#dd8d8d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d8d8d has RGB values of R:221, G:141,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.36,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14519693.

Shades and Tints of #dd8d8d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070202 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f7 is the lightest one.
